Chem Mill Operator tends equipment that chemically cleans oil, grease, dirt, and other foreign matter from parts/metal objects as well as chemically milling of part(s).

Founded in 1849, Ducommun is the oldest company in California. Starting as a hardware supply store during the California Gold Rush and eventually assisted in the birth of the aerospace industry in Southern California by providing aircraft aluminum to early aerospace pioneers like Lindbergh, Douglas and Lockheed.
Today Ducommun is a global provider of innovative manufacturing solutions for customers in the aerospace, defense and industrial markets. We specialize in electronic and structural systems, producing complex products and components for commercial aircraft platforms, mission-critical military and space programs, and sophisticated industrial applications.

Job Summary
Removes oil, grease, dirt, and mil markings from material.
Loads objects in baskets on conveyor that carries them through series of chemical and rinsing baths, or places objects on racks or in containers and immerses objects in chemical and rinsing solutions.
Moves control to start conveyor and to regulate conveyor speed.
Maintains consistency of cleaning solutions by adding specified amount of chemical to solutions.
Drains, cleans, and refills tanks with chemicals.Dries objects.
Examines cleaned objects to ensure conformance to standards.
Measures parts and part thickness.
Hangs parts and sprays with maskant.
Ability to use a die grinder.
Scribes parts to meet work order and customer specifications.
Performs chemical milling operations.
Responsible for the proper handling and management of hazardous waste generated in their work area.
Accurately records required information in customer required log books.
